Prompt to unlock login keyring sometimes doesn't appear after auto-login
Affected version
- Fedora 32 (Workstation Edition)
- GNOME 3.36.1
- X11 (haven't tried Wayland)
Bug summary
With auto-login enabled, there is a chance that a prompt to unlock the login keyring doesn't appear after login. When that happens, it's also not possible to unlock the login keyring afterwards with Seahorse.
This occurs even with shell extensions disabled.
Steps to reproduce
- Optional: Use GNOME Tweaks to add some Startup Applications that make use of the login keyring, like any apps that use GNOME Online Accounts.
- In Settings->Users, enable Automatic Login for your account.
- Reboot.
What happened
The system will automatically log in to your account (as expected), but sometimes no modal shell prompt appears for entering your login keyring password.
Apps that use the login keyring won't work properly, even if they are Startup Applications that launched automatically.
Opening Seahorse and clicking to unlock the login keyring will hang indefinitely.
What did you expect to happen
The password prompt should always appear.
